![]() As far as expansions go, a couple were already approved, Wages of Sin for SiN and Hellfire for Diablo come to mind. But there is a factor which in my opinion doesn't allow us to associate shareware episodes with expansions. Expansions were sold, shareware episodes were not. Not mentioning the fact that noone considers these episodes as separate full games, there's also the fact that abandonware in AB rules implies it was commercially distributed at a time, which shareware was obviously not.
Now this makes things interesting. There's the problem with Commander Keen again. Thus I'd advise we should not make separate pages for every episode, but rather for every batch. Eps 1,2,3 were clearly sold as Commander Keen: Invasion of the Vorticons, and 4 and 5 were Commander Keen: Goodbye Galaxy! So I'd suggest we review them as 3D Realms themselves distributes them: - http://www.3drealms.com/keen1/ - http://www.3drealms.com/keen4/ ...plus the others which were distributed separately (3.5, 6) Now regarding the aforementioned expansion. Doing reviews for them is not exactly a problem. The problem occurs that they can't be run without the original game (both Diablo and SiN are sold), and current policy doesn't allow us to upload ISOs/cd images, but only the zipped installed folder. So how will we get out of this situation.

![]() Its not just Commander Keen though, Apogee did it a lot. Crystal Caves, Secret Agent have multiple episodes launched from seperate .exes, the first one being Shareware. These games are meant to come together but are seperated by episode. I agree that if we do host them it should be in the full versions of each game how they were intended.
